What is the CryptoAnalysisMCP MCP server?

A Model Context Protocol (MCP) server for comprehensive cryptocurrency technical analysis. Built with Swift, it provides real-time price data, technical indicators, chart pattern detection, and trading signals for over 7 million. Exposed over MCP by the cryptoanalysismcp mcp server, that capability becomes something an assistant can invoke while it works, not something you go and do afterwards.

What it actually does

  • Universal Token Support — 7+ MILLION tokens through DexPaprika integration
  • Liquidity Pool Analytics — Monitor liquidity, volume, and pool data across DEXes
  • Dynamic Symbol Resolution — Automatically supports all cryptocurrencies
  • Real-time Price Data — Current prices, volume, market cap, and percentage changes
  • Technical Indicators — RSI, MACD, Moving Averages, Bollinger Bands, and more
  • Chart Pattern Detection — Head & shoulders, triangles, double tops/bottoms

How to install the CryptoAnalysisMCP MCP server

{
  "mcpServers": {
    "crypto-analysis": {
      "command": "/path/to/crypto-analysis-mcp",
      "env": {
        "COINPAPRIKA_API_KEY": "your-free-api-key-here"
      }
    }
  }
}

Configuration as documented by the project. Restart the client after saving.
